Twelve Angry Men (1957)

Re-enactment

Juror 8 (Henry Fonda) does a re-enactment of the old man’s story which leads to a showdown with Juror 3 (Lee J. Cobb) and a dramatic revelation.

Directed by Sidney Lumet.

Released in 1957 by MGM.
